The postcode IP33 3NZ is located in West Suffolk, in the county of Suffolk.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. IP33 3NZ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

IP33 3NZ is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of IP33 3NZ as Constrained city dwellers > Challenged diversity > Transitional Eastern European neighbourhood.

The closest road name to IP33 3NZ is Eyre Close which is centered 100 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Albert Buildings and is 9 m away. The closest railway station is Entrance, 1.46 km away.

The closest primary school to IP33 3NZ (for ages 11 and under) is St Edmund's Catholic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on February 21,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St Benedict's Catholic School. The last OFSTED inspection on September 29, 2016 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of IP33 3NZ is Hunter Club and is 173 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 3,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from West End Fish and Chip Shop and is 0 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on April 5,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 84.5 Mbps and an average upload speed of 18.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 87.9%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.9 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for IP33 3NZ is covered by the Suffolk police force association and Suffolk is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
